Veil Of The World

I'm a beginning without an end.

I come from millennium's past

And belong to eternity.


I roll and roar,

In crests and troughs,

An eternal motion.

I swell in pride,

And move from deep water to peaking waves,

In transition. 


Seeing a shore up ahead I soften into breakers,

And spray my salty white foam on virgin beaches.


I'm silver or gold,

Bathed in moonlight or sunshine.

Cyan or aquamarine,

And at times a midnight blue.

Phytoplankton and algae 

Turn me green.

And on a moonless night

I'm a bewitching black,

Mysterious and frightening.


My myriad moods cast a spell,

I gently lap under a still sky,

I lash the rocks when the moon calls.

Deep within, my master dictates 

And I serve his commands.


The protector of the ocean world, 

Its secrets below. 

Concealing its treasures 

From greedy eyes.

Constantly in turmoil

To ensure peace within 

For millions of living things.

The rainforests of the ocean, 

The coral reefs.


I hide two million unclassified species.

And almost 230 million known ones.


I nourish, I nurture.

I converse with the clouds,

Whispering my tales to their keen ears.

They thunder back in response 

And I rise to the tempo.


Love, longing, 

Tears, regret...

people share everything with me.

I hear their prayers and songs.

I calm their burning hearts

And spray some love.

I tell them I have tears too,

Taste my woes.

But I won't tell.


Open your arms, I shall embrace you with grace.

Leave behind a memory for you

To calm you in turbulent times.

My tiny mementos you can take back,

And when you are wistful or sad,

Put your ear to my sea shell.


And softly I'll murmur my stories from deep beneath,

And show you sights 

From across the horizon. 

I'm the waves of time,

The force of life,

That undefined,

Immeasurable,

Inexplicable, 

Unending,

Incomprehensible idiom,

A challenge to mankind.
